The Czech phrase translates to "Coming soon" or "Very soon" . As an essay topic, it offers a rich opportunity to explore the human experience of anticipation, the nature of time, or the anxiety of a rapidly changing future.

The Paradox of "Již Brzy": Living in the Shadow of the Future

Ultimately, "Již brzy" is a mirror of the human condition. We are creatures of progress, always reaching for the next horizon. While anticipation can drive innovation and personal growth, the true challenge is to find balance. We must learn to look forward to the future without letting the promise of "soon" diminish the reality of "today." The future will arrive in its own time; our task is to be ready for it when it does.
